Surgery One of the most popular and successful kidney cancer treatments is surgery when the tumor is confined. Surgeons remove malignancies or benign kidneys. Only the tumor is removed in a partial nephrectomy, therefore maintaining kidney function. Extreme cases might call for a radical nephrectomy—that is, the kidney and surrounding tissue are removed. Cryotherapy Cryotherapy kills tumors by freezing cancer cells. Inserting a tiny needle into the tumor and freezing it kills cancer cells.
